Best ways to get from Howell Hall to Dollhouse Lounge & Burlesque

Alternative transportation options

MORE INFORMATION

Howell Hall

Howell Hall was first built in 1949, and was renovated in 1962, 1974, and 1980. The Howell Hall Science Lab was built in 1994.

Address:100 N University Dr, Edmond, OK 73034
  • College Science Buildings
  • College Labs

Neighborhood data provided by Zillow. Venue data powered by Foursquare.